Hello,

I work in an IT department and we recently received our first Vista machine
the other day. Part of our setup procedure is to create a baseline user
account on each machine we setup that has the desktop, folder views and
application configurations all set to our standard. Then we copy this profile
to all the other users of that machine. This has not been a problem in W2K
nor XP, just got to "System Properties" -> Advanced -> User Profiles
(Settings) and copy the profiles. However, whenever I do this under Vista and
then have the user attempt to log back in they get the Welcome message and
then immediately you see the Logging off.. message, so they can no longer log
onto the machine! These are the users whose are on the receiving end of the
profile copy.

Has anyone else experienced this problem. Does anyone know if this is a
Vista problem or should this work?
